CKENERGY ELECTRIC COOPERATIVE INC, founded in 2016, is a mid-sized nonprofit that reported $87.2M in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. Revenue decreased 10% compared to the prior year.

Mission

TO PROVIDE QUALITY AND RELIABLE ELECTRIC SERVICE TO MEMBERS OF THE COOPERATIVE.
